Comparison review

Motorola DROID Turbo is a bit better than Asus ZenFone 5Q, with a global score of 77.9 against 72.6. Even being the best cellphone in this review, it must be noted that it's also a noticeably older, notably thicker and just a little heavier cellphone. Motorola DROID Turbo has just a little better hardware performance than Asus ZenFone 5Q, because although it has a smaller amount of RAM and less processing cores (but faster), it also counts with an extra graphics processing unit.

Motorola DROID Turbo features a much better display than Asus ZenFone 5Q, because although it has a quite smaller screen, it also counts with a greater quantity of pixels per screen inch and a better resolution of 2560 x 1440px. Asus ZenFone 5Q has a much bigger memory to install applications and games than Motorola DROID Turbo, and although they both have equal internal memory capacity, the Asus ZenFone 5Q also has a SD card slot that holds up to 1,95 TB.

Motorola DROID Turbo counts with just a bit better camera than Asus ZenFone 5Q, because although it has slower 24 frames per second video frame rates, and they both have the same 3840x2160 (4K) video quality, the Motorola DROID Turbo also counts with a larger diafragm aperture to capture better low light photography and a much higher resolution back camera.

The Motorola DROID Turbo counts with greater battery lifetime than Asus ZenFone 5Q, because it has an 18 percent more battery size.

In addition to being the best phone of the ones we are comparing here, the Motorola DROID Turbo is also a lot cheaper, which makes it a great choice.
